Smart Bathroom Storage That Stays Put
Making the most of your travel trailer’s compact bathroom requires smart storage solutions that won’t shift during transit.
Consider adding peel and stick hooks for lightweight organization that stays secure. Install command hooks for towels and robes, using weight-rated options for heavier items.
Before installing any organizers, thoroughly assess available space by measuring and identifying potential storage areas in your bathroom’s layout.
Maximize vertical space with over-the-door organizers featuring clear pockets, and utilize magnetic racks on metal surfaces.

Kitchen Counter Space-Saving Essentials
Space-conscious travelers understand that kitchen counter real estate is precious in a travel trailer.
Maximize efficiency with sink and stove covers that create extra prep surfaces, while collapsible measuring tools and dish racks save valuable space.
Consider installing convenient fold-down counter extensions that instantly expand your work area when needed.
Keeping your seasonings organized is simple with a magnetic wall rack that utilizes vertical space. Install magnetic strips for utensils, and choose multi-function appliances like Instant Pots.

Space-Maximizing Door and Cabinet Solutions
Smart door and cabinet solutions transform your travel trailer’s limited space into an efficient storage haven.
Install magnetic catches for lightweight doors and spring-loaded latches for heavier ones to guarantee secure closure during travel.
Maximize space with push-to-open mechanisms and foldable doors, while adjustable shelving and tiered racks help organize your belongings effectively in cabinets.
